Gary Megson's Bolton will be hoping to make it two wins in two games when they welcome Blackburn to the Reebok Stadium for the Lancashire derby.

Despite their position just above the drop zone, Bolton are just three points off 10th-placed Blackburn, who are bidding to defeat Gary Megson's side for the fourth consecutive time in the Premier League.

After an impressive performance and victory against West Ham at Upton Park before the international break, confidence will be booming for the Trotters as they bid for just their third Premier League win of the season.

With two tough fixtures against Arsenal and Manchester United behind them, Megson's men bounced back with a terrific performance against West Ham and, given a similar display, could make it two in a row against local rivals Rovers.

Decent start

Paul Ince's side were left licking their wounds after a disappointing display against the Red Devils last time out.

Despite that defeat, Ince's men have made a solid start to the season and have won two of their three games on the road so far this term.

Prior to the United setback, Rovers were enjoying a good run, winning three games on the bounce including theur Carling Cup tie against Everton.

Blackburn also have an impressive unbeaten record at Bolton in recent years, winning three and drawing four of their last seven league meetings.

Bolton duo Heidar Helguson and Gretar Steinsson picked up knocks while on international duty this week but both should be fit for Saturday's encounter.

Blackburn will be without midfielder Steven Reid who is out for the rest of the season with a knee injury.

With David Dunn also out long-term, Ince will have limited options in midfield on Sunday.

Roque Satnta Cruz (hamstring) is a doubtful but Benni McCarthy, Vince Grella and goalkeeper Paul Robinson are all fit.
